Types of Air flow Techniques

Invasive vs. Non-invasive Ventilation

Invasive air flow entails inserting an endotracheal tube right into a client's airway, while non-invasive air flow uses masks or nasal prongs. Recognizing these differences helps healthcare providers select the suitable method based upon client needs.

Modes of Mechanical Ventilation

Mechanical ventilators can run in numerous settings, including:

    Assist-Control (AIR CONDITIONER): The maker supplies breaths at an established rate but enables individuals to launch additional breaths. Synchronized Intermittent Necessary Ventilation (SIMV): The maker offers a combination of required breaths and permits spontaneous breathing. Pressure Assistance Ventilation (PSV): The ventilator helps each breath started by the person approximately a predetermined pressure level.

Knowing when to use each mode is important for reliable air flow management.

Monitoring Clients on Mechanical Ventilation

Key Criteria in Patient Monitoring

Monitoring people on mechanical air flow includes analyzing several criteria:

Oxygen saturation levels End-tidal co2 (ETCO2) Respiratory rate Tidal quantity delivered

Continuous surveillance makes it possible for fast treatment if complications arise.

Recognizing Alarms: What They Mean?

Understanding numerous alarm signals from a ventilator-- such as high-pressure alarms or reduced tidal volume alarms-- helps clinicians respond quickly to possible concerns impacting individual safety.
